在聊区块链之前,我想大家可能会先有个疑问:“区块链到底是什么东西?”简单来说,区块链就像一个很大的、超级安全的电子账本,记录着所有的数据流转。你可以想象一下,之前我们在纸上记账的方式,现在都变成电子了,连锁金融、管理、医疗等各个领域都有它的身影。
不过,别以为区块链就只是个账本那么简单,它的出现撼动了我们对数据的管理方式,对业务流程的透明性、安全性都带来了极大的提升。这就引出了我们今天的主题——区块链基础平台的建设方案。这可不是光说说的,背后需要很深的技术架构和落地实践。
首先,区块链因为其不可篡改性,以及跨机构的数据共享特性,受到了各行各业的追捧。不管是处理金融交易,还是在供应链管理、医疗健康方面,区块链都能够提供极高的透明度和效率。
想象一下,过去我们在处理一笔交易时,可能需要多方确认、反复查验,而使用了区块链后,信息只需在链上记录一次,所有参与者都能实时查看,这大大节省了时间和人力成本。
谈到技术架构,我觉得这是区块链基础平台建设中最核心的部分。一个完善的区块链平台通常包括这几个关键组成部分:
要搭建好一个区块链基础平台,这些层次你都得考虑到,不然真的是“头痛医头,脚痛医脚”。
前段时间,我有个朋友在一家初创公司工作,他们就是最近在忙着搭建自己的区块链平台。让我看到了区块链技术落地的真实场景。
他们首先做了市场调研,发现自己所在的行业,数据透明度和安全性是个大问题。于是,就想着利用区块链来改善这个现状。接着,他们请了一些技术团队,开始进行架构设计。
在共识机制上,他们选择了权益证明,毕竟这个机制比较环保,对硬件需求也低。这时,团队里几位技工紧张地计算着数据存储的平均开销,真的是一副“攻城略地”的样子。同时,为了确保平台的可拓展性,他们还搭建了一个灵活的API接口,以便未来可以快速融合更多服务。
当然,建设过程中也不是一帆风顺的。为了确保数据的安全性,他们在选择区块链平台上纠结许久,最后决定选用一个底层公链方案来保障数据透明。
但接下来开会讨论的时候,总是有人提到“这存在性能瓶颈”的问题。毕竟,不同的共识机制对性能有直接影响,有的适合小规模应用,而有的则可能遭遇“吞吐量不足”的窘境。
这让我想到了“别只盯着技术,别忘了用户需求”。有时用户需要的并不是你想象中那么复杂,只需要稳定、简单的功能。你想想,如果是你用手机来转账,能不能把这个过程做得尽量简洁流畅?这才是重点。
在经历了一段时间的架构搭建后,他们进入了测试阶段。这个阶段其实是最重要的,尤其是针对智能合约的测试。因为一旦上线,如果出现问题,那可是相当麻烦的事情。
他们进行了模拟交易,在沙盒环境中测试,确保所有的逻辑都无懈可击。过程中还发现几个小bug,及时调整了逻辑,真是“细节决定成败”。
没错,平台上线只是开始,后续的运营和维护同样关键。比如,定期更新区块链的节点,确保网络健康运行;针对用户反馈,快速迭代产品。大家应该知道,技术总在发展,我们得跟上节奏。
而且,这个平台还需要建立一个社区,吸引更多开发者参与进来。这就像开一个美食节,吸引众多小吃摊来参与,才能让这个节日热闹起来。
说到最后,区块链的未来真是充满了想象。有企业正在探索跨链技术,意味着不同区块链之间能够无缝通讯,我们的生活得以更加便捷。
在这个过程中,安全问题依旧是个挑战,如何防范攻击,确保用户信息安全,这是每个企业必须面对的难题。但我相信,只要不断探索、不断创新,区块链必将在未来发展的浪潮中迎来更加美好的明天。
说到这里,希望我刚才分享的内容能对你们有所帮助。区块链这个话题真的是越聊越有意思,知识的海洋广阔无垠,我还会继续关注这一领域的最新动态,也希望能与你们共同探讨!如果你有自己的看法,欢迎下方留言,我们一起畅聊!